Mom was born October 4, 1939 and she was the third eldest in a family of seven. She attended Rembrandt School and completed her education at Churchill High and Teachers College. Mom taught in one room school houses until the amalgamation in 1967. After this she joined the family business, Arborg Bakery, where she carried on until 1983. Mom loved her home, garden, and best of all cooking for her family. Her grandchildren loved her perogies, borscht, and her special baking that she did for each one of them. During her life she was active in her community, mom was a lifelong member of the Legion Ladies Auxiliary branch, where she was awarded with a 40-year service award for being treasurer. Mom was also a very active member of St. Philips Roman Catholic Church in Arborg, and in the Chatfield Community Club as a treasurer and volunteer worker. Mom also enjoyed volunteering and spending time with the ladies from Meleb Park. Those who knew mom, knew she poured her heart into everything she was involved with.
